1. How should lamps be used when a motor vehicle meets an oncoming bicycle on a narrow road or a narrow bridge at night?

A. Continuously change between low-beam and high-beam

B. Use clearance lamp

C. Use high-beam

D. Use low-beam

Answer: D

2. Matches, sulfur and red phosphorus are _________.

A. Explosives

B. Inflammable solid materials

C. Self-igniting articles

D. Oxidizing materials

Answer: B

3. When a wounded person is under the wheel or cargo, the wrong method is to pull the limbs of the wounded.

Answer: N

6. When rescuing the injured, it is necessary to ________.

A. Save life first and treat the wounds later

B. Treat the wounds first and safe life later

C. Help the slightly wounded persons first

D. Help the seriously wounded persons later

Answer: A

7. When following other vehicles on a foggy day, what should the driver do?

A. Maintain a large safety distance

B. Turn on the high-beam

C. Turn on the low-bea

D. Sound the horn in due time

Answer: A

8. At the scene of a traffic accident, once there is a leakage of toxic and harmful substances, people must be evacuated at the first time and alarmed immediately.

Answer: Y

10. How to reduce speed or stop when driving on a road covered with snow and ice?

A. Take full advantage of driving brake

B. Take full advantage of the control power from engine

C. Take full advantage of parking brake

D. Take full advantage of speed retarder

Answer: B

12. How to ensure safe driving at night?

A. Drive at speed limit

B. Cut speed and drive carefully

C. Maintain the current speed

D. Drive above the speed limit

Answer: B

14. When encountering an obstacle on one side of the road, what should vehicles do as they approach each other?

A. The vehicle not encountering an obstacle should Yield to the other vehicle

B. The slower vehicle should yield to the faster

C. The vehicle encountering an obstacle should yield to the other vehicle

D. The faster vehicle should yield to the slower

Answer: C

15. When rescuers enter the scene to rescue the wounded after harmful gas leakage caused by traffic accidents, they must wear air respirators or cover their mouth and nose with wet towels.

Answer: Y

16. When driving on road sections where safe sight distance is affected, such as the top of a ramp, what should drivers do to ensure safety?

A. Rush through

B. Use hazard lamp

C. Cut speed and sound the horn

D. Drive at will

Answer: C

17. When there is bleeding at the bone fracture of a wounded person, the first thing to do is to keep it in position before stopping the bleeding and dress the wound.

Answer: N

19. When approaching a vehicle on a narrow slope, which one of the following ways is correct?

A. The descending vehicle yields to the ascending

B. The vehicle which is further from the slope crest should yield

C. The ascending vehicle yields to the descending

D. If the descending vehicle has reached the midpoint while the ascending vehicle has not yet set out, the descending vehicle must yield.

Answer: A

20. What should the driver do when he/she encounters an oncoming ambulance in the same lane?

A. Keep to the side and reduce speed or stop to yield

B. Drive ahead by occupying another lane

C. Yield by speeding up and changing lanes

D. Drive ahead in the original lane

Answer: A
